Output 632e3ecc23cfb9fc470009778303b729afe75e8b90ec740c72f67c15339b2f3e:0

value
947694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e940f13513e1b96ce713f0a5b9d7f264ca40c1a5 OP_EQUAL
address
3NxMAWDUYqiubVwG1yM8aT66toUNCjFP55
transaction
632e3ecc23cfb9fc470009778303b729afe75e8b90ec740c72f67c15339b2f3e
confirmations
266587
spent
true